Analysis Summary
----------------

BGP routing table entries examined:                               18883
    Prefixes after maximum aggregation (per Origin AS):           10691
    Deaggregation factor:                                          1.77
    Unique aggregates announced (without unneeded subnets):       11976
Total ASes present in the Internet Routing Table:                  2698
    Prefixes per ASN:                                              7.00
Origin-only ASes present in the Internet Routing Table:            2287
Origin ASes announcing only one prefix:                            1053
Transit ASes present in the Internet Routing Table:                 411
Transit-only ASes present in the Internet Routing Table:             78
Average AS path length visible in the Internet Routing Table:       5.5
    Max AS path length visible:                                      18
    Max AS path prepend of ASN ( 10497)                              11
Prefixes from unregistered ASNs in the Routing Table:                20
    Number of instances of unregistered ASNs:                        20
Number of 32-bit ASNs allocated by the RIRs:                      31499
Number of 32-bit ASNs visible in the Routing Table:                 486
Prefixes from 32-bit ASNs in the Routing Table:                    1531
Number of bogon 32-bit ASNs visible in the Routing Table:             0
Special use prefixes present in the Routing Table:                    1
Prefixes being announced from unallocated address space:              0
Number of addresses announced to Internet:                    210009660
    Equivalent to 12 /8s, 132 /16s and 126 /24s
    Percentage of available address space announced:                5.7
    Percentage of allocated address space announced:                5.7
    Percentage of available address space allocated:              100.0
    Percentage of address space in use by end-sites:               99.5
Total number of prefixes smaller than registry allocations:        8103
